Network like a Pro
Trythese
5questions
1. “What Do You Like Best about What You Do?”
• Direct to a more interesting conversation
about the other person’s – Business– his likes and dislikes – his experience and so forth
• Better than simply asking, “What do you do?”
2. “You Mentioned that You Were in [Industry]. What Got You Started in that Direction?”
• gives a chance to talk about personal goals and desires and to look favorably on
the asker. It also gives insight into how dedicated she is to her profession and how proficient she may be at it.
3. “Where Else Do You Usually Network?”
• Can be the ice breaker during that awkward period just after introductions
• offers the chance to talk about something common to both parties, creating an opportunity to make an instant connection.
4. “What Are Some of Your Biggest Challenges?”
• This can be used toward the end of the conversation. It allows the opportunity to learn about the other party’s reasons, passion and motivation for being in her specific business in the first place.
5) “How Can I Help You?”
If you decide the person you’re talking with is someone you’d like to have in your network, this is a good question to ask. Being helpful is the best way to start building a solid relationship.
